BUTTER PECAN COOKIES

BEST FALL TREAT

These Butter Pecan Cookies are soft, slightly crispy, and wildly delicious! They’re the signature combo of brown butter, pecans, and brown sugary sweetness!

– butter – brown sugar – egg – vanilla extract – all purpose flour – baking soda – chopped pecans

Place 1 stick of butter in a  pan and heat over  medium heat until melted.   TCook it for approximately 5 minutes until it turns light brown, stirring often.

Add the browned butter to a large  bowl. Melt the other 4 tablespoons  of butter in microwave and add it to the bowl with the browned butter.

Add the brown sugar and beat with electric mixer or whisk to combine. Then add egg and vanilla extract and blend in

In a separate small bowl, add the flour and baking soda and toss to mix together. Add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ients and mix until just barely combined and large lumps of flour are mixing in.

Add the pecans and gently stir them into the dough until the pecans are evenly distributed.

Place the bowl in the refrigerator for 30 minutes to chill.  Preheat the oven to 375 ° F while the dough is in the refrigerator.

After chilling, scoop  1 ½ tablespoons dough and place  on parchment lined baking sheet 2 inches apart. Press down to ½” inch thick.

Bake for 12-14 minutes

VARIATIONS 1. Stir in ½ cup of white chocolate chips or toffee bits to the batter. 2. Roll the balls of dough in white sugar before baking. 3. sprinkle each cookie with some coarse salt 4. Add some cinnamon to your cookie dough.
